HEAVY GALE IN SOUTH CANTERBURY.

THE TELEGRAPH LINES BROKEN. (Pek United Pbess Association.) Asiiuubton, September 10. A severe gale from the north-west was experienced here last eveuing. The wind blew pretty strongly all the afternoon, but about 9 o'clock it sprang up with hurricane force, and so continued for about two hours. A considerable amount of damage was done. One of the end walls of the Boys' High School, a brick building, fell out owing to the vibration of the building. A Catholic church in coursa or construction at Methven is reported to have been demolished. A good deal of the roof of the N.Z.L. and M A. Company's store was blown off, and the main street was littered with sheets of galvanised iron. Blacksmiths' shops at Tinwald and Wakanui, were wrecked, and also a grain shed on. the Westerned station. Many chimneys were blown down, and some windows in shops and many in private houees were blown in. Some paddocks of late sown wheat, where the grain had not made sufficient roots to hold have been destroyed, the soil down to the bottom of the plough being blown clear away. The telegraph line suffered severely, and owing to the number of posts blown down communication north and south is carried on with difficulty. The g tie was tho severest experienced here for many years. Timabu, September 10. A great north-west gale swept across the plains last evening. All the wires are dowD between here and Christcburch, and only one wire is left north of there. The greatest streugth of the gale appears to have been about Timaru. A good deal of damage was done.
